Transaction de8d8e3693a409525ecfaf6125e506509d8cd32f7ab1047a216de33122ad0a7e
1 Input
1 Output
-
de8d8e3693a409525ecfaf6125e506509d8cd32f7ab1047a216de33122ad0a7e:0
- value
- 522770
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ae93870eecb4d02a98c5205aa7e123b2927673c
- address
- bc1qpt5nsu8wedxs92vv2gz65lsj8v5jweeue4040t